ВУЗ:
Составители:
Рубрика:
155
for j:=1 to 4 do
begin {переписываем одномерный массив в двумерный}
a[i,j]:=b[q];
q:=q+1;
end;
writeln('результат');
for i:=1 to 4 do
begin {вывод результата}
for j:=1 to 4 do
write(a[i,j]:3);
writeln;
end;
readln;
end.
Пример 8.9. Сортировка двумерных массивов. Расположить по
возрастанию элементы каждой строки двумерного массива методом пар-
ных перестановок.
program sortm7;
type
an = array [1..4] of integer;.
var
a:array [1..4] of an;
n,l,j:byte;
k, q:integer;
begin
writeln ('Исходный массив');
randomize; {ввод исходного массива с помощью}
for j:=1 to 4 do {датчика случайных чисел}
for l:=1 to 4 do
a[j,l]:=random(100);
for j:=1 to 4 do
begin
for l:=1 to 4 do
write(a[j,l],' ');
writeln;
end;
n:=4;
for j:=1 to 4 do
begin {начало сортировки по строкам}
repeat
k:=0;
for l:=1 to n–1 do
Страницы
- « первая
- ‹ предыдущая
- …
- 153
- 154
- 155
- 156
- 157
- …
- следующая ›
- последняя »
